Traditionally Crozes has been overshadowed by its neighbour Hermitage, yet the wines of top producers in the region often achieve comparable quality and sell for a fraction of the price. The grapes for Les Deux Côtes were hand harvested from two very different terroirs within Crozes Hermitage , the first from granite slopes, which give the wine its firm structure, and the second from vines grown on rocky alluvial terraces, which contribute rich fruit flavours. Xavier Frouin, a veteran Rhône winemaker, and Olivier Ciosi, who has worked in top regions in Italy, Nya Zeeland and Australia, took advantage of a superb vintage to produce this richly flavoured and beautifully elegant wine , a perfect partner to roast lamb or duck with cherry sauce.
